javascript的简写是什么?
传达上述语句的最有效方式是什么?尝试内联IF语句(三元运算符):javascript的简写是什么?,javascript,Javascript,传达上述语句的最有效方式是什么?尝试内联IF语句(三元运算符): Math.max函数返回零个或多个数字中的最大值 您可以使用Math.max获取两个值中的最大值,highest和pf[i].length highest = Math.max(pf[i].length, highest) 或者,也可以使用三元运算符 highest = Math.max(highest, pf[i].length); 返回三值运算的值,并将其设置为称为三值运算的变量最高值。另外,在false的情况下,这是否会
Math.max
函数返回零个或多个数字中的最大值
您可以使用
Math.max
获取两个值中的最大值,highest
和pf[i].length
highest = Math.max(pf[i].length, highest)
或者,也可以使用三元运算符
highest = Math.max(highest, pf[i].length);
返回三值运算的值,并将其设置为称为三值运算的变量
最高值
。另外,在false的情况下,这是否会不希望地用空字符串覆盖highest
?我建议…:最高代码>你是说最简洁吗?可读的?因为在计算效率方面,很难击败这一点。出于好奇,可能的复制品,零的最大值意味着什么?你会用它做什么呢?根据“如果没有给出参数,结果是-无穷大”。这在比较一个Math.max调用与另一个调用的结果时可能很有用。或者,当您选择arg时,arg的数量仅在运行时已知,并且可能为零
highest = Math.max(pf[i].length, highest)
highest = Math.max(highest, pf[i].length);
highest = pf[i].length > highest ? pf[i].length : highest;
// ^^^^^^^^^^^^^^^^^^^^^^ Condition
// ^^^^^^^^^^^^ Execute when True
// ^^^^^^^ Execute when False